Eclty1� ,.,�� Request for Action <br /> River <br /> To Item Number <br /> Mayor and City Council 8.6 <br /> Agenda Section Meeting Date Prepared by <br /> General Business August 5, 2013 Suzanne Fischer, Community Operations & <br /> Development Director <br /> Item Description Reviewed by <br /> Recap of Maintenance Facility Open House Cal Portner, City Administrator <br /> Reviewed by <br /> Action Requested <br /> None—Informational <br /> Background/Discussion <br /> Every year,National Public Works Week is celebrated across the country to acquaint residents to the <br /> programs,projects, and services that Public Works and Park Departments offer to a community. The <br /> event is typically celebrated in May,but ours was held on July 31 to accommodate residual work on the <br /> Maintenance Facility building. <br /> The event gave residents an opportunity to meet staff, tour the building and garage, see various types of <br /> equipment,learn more about municipal activities, and simply gain a better understanding of what the <br /> departments do for the community. The event attracted approximately 500 individuals including residents <br /> and families,retirees,local municipal and county representatives, contractors, suppliers, and local business <br /> owners. <br /> With the help of local sponsorships and goodwill gestures from a few residents,it was a positive and <br /> successful event. <br /> Financial Impact <br /> N/A <br /> Attachments <br /> ■ None <br /> POWERED By <br /> A IR <br />
